Yext (YEXT) EBIT (2016 - 2026)

Yext (YEXT) has 11 years of EBIT data on record, last reported at $6.0 million in Q1 2026.

  • On a quarterly basis, EBIT rose 165.76% to $6.0 million in Q1 2026 year-over-year; TTM through Jan 2026 was $44.5 million, a 237.29% increase, with the full-year FY2026 number at $44.5 million, up 237.29% from a year prior.
  • EBIT reached $6.0 million in Q1 2026 per YEXT's latest filing, down from $7.8 million in the prior quarter.
  • Over the last five years, EBIT for YEXT hit a ceiling of $29.7 million in Q3 2025 and a floor of -$25.5 million in Q2 2022.
  • A 5-year average of -$4.8 million and a median of -$5.4 million in 2024 define the central range for EBIT.
  • On a YoY basis, EBIT climbed as much as 492.2% in 2025 and fell as far as 971.33% in 2025.
  • Tracing YEXT's EBIT over 5 years: stood at -$12.1 million in 2022, then surged by 85.32% to -$1.8 million in 2023, then plummeted by 482.14% to -$10.4 million in 2024, then soared by 175.04% to $7.8 million in 2025, then decreased by 23.19% to $6.0 million in 2026.
